BugKu 2B+基于python的opencv的安装-------CTF 盲水印的套路

BugKu杂项-2B

下载图片后,binwalk下跑一跑,发现有个zip,分离。

值得一提的是,这个zip是伪加密的。

1397720-20180814213622538-564483024.jpg

但是你在分离的时候,伪加密的图片也给你分离出来了。这两个图片2B和B2肉眼看起来长得是一样的,名字也很有意思。

2B和B2这两张极为相似的,这时候想到就是隐写里的提取盲水印,脚本我目前找到了两个(需要opencv,下面会有安装方法),并且这两个不完全一样,怎么说呢,用其中一个加上水印,用另一个解不开,所以还是都存起来吧。下载地址:

https://github.com/linyacool/blind-watermark  
https://github.com/YvesZHI/BlindWaterMark  

幸运的是,用其中的一个顺利的提取出来flag

1397720-20180814213633461-1971455934.jpg

1397720-20180814213705758-1930715111.png

但是另一个就不是这样了。

1397720-20180814213724220-937702144.png

windows下基于python的opencv的安装

上边的脚本必须得有python环境下的opencv,我们进行安装。

cmd下,输入: pip install opencv-python等待,可能有点慢,安装完成后。cmd下输入python进入交互模式。输入import cv2,没有报错即可。

1397720-20180814213759084-706660036.jpg

这里我去运行脚本,它提示我没有这个matplotlib

如果你能够直接运行,那就到此为止了,我的是csdn下的纯净版的旗舰版win7,还需要安装matplotlib,cmd命令下输入pip install matplotlib就好了。

转载于:https://www.cnblogs.com/zaqzzz/p/9478086.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值